In 1857, Harriet Small is given her father's True Narrative of his life - his escape from slavery in America and his journey into the heart of revolutionary Ireland. The story of Tony Small and Lord Edward Fitzgerald, 'Words to Shape My Name' is about hope, failure, resilience, and narrative - an adventure of great intelligence and awareness.
